
Robin Thicke stirred
controversy with his steamy video for “Blurred Lines,” and he’s about to
heat up the screen again. The R&B crooner, whose T.I. and
Pharrell-assisted hit is No. 1 for a 11th consecutive week, reteamed
with director Diane Martel to shoot a sex-drenched video for his new single “Give It 2 U” featuring Kendrick Lamar and 2 Chainz.
A shirtless Thicke hit the football field with his sexy co-stars, dressed as football players and cotton candy. “It’s a Diane Martel dream, and I’m just happy to be here,” he told source.
“The thing about Diane Martel that makes it so amazing—besides just
being a crazy genius—is that she combines all different parts of the
world into one soup. She takes the cotton candy, she takes the beautiful football-playing girls and she mixes it all up into one beautiful pot. So we’re all very lucky to have her and excited to be working with her again.”




Kendrick drove a mini-truck down the 25-yard line with a lady in his
lap as confetti flew across the field. “Kendrick is driving mini
monster trucks, and he’s a genius,” said Thicke. “We’re just excited to have him here, to have him on the song and as part of this video.”
